Birthdate: October 6, 1459
Sun Sign: Libra
Birthplace: Nürnberg, Germany
Died: July 29, 1507
Martin Behaim, a German textile merchant and cartographer, advised John II of Portugal on navigation. He created the Erdapfel, the world’s oldest known globe in 1492 for the Imperial City of Nuremberg. Behaim’s expertise in cartography and navigation made significant contributions to the exploration and understanding of the world during the Age of Discovery, leaving a lasting legacy in geography.
